Cactus-inspired shot cups for your best tequila or mezcal, handmade in Mexico.
From the women's collective that makes our bean pots in Los Reyes Metzontle. The clay is very special to the region and actually has talc in it. There is no fear of lead as the pieces are unglazed. Instead, they're burnished with quartz rocks.
The caballitos are clay shot cups that look like small cactus and are perfect for a healthy and generous shot of tequila, mezcal, or whatever your poison you prefer. Unlike other items we sell from Los Reyes Metzontle, the caballitos have a darker colored slip on the inside, making them glossier than the simple burnishing on the outside.
The caballitos come in a set of four.
Please note: These items are handmade and there will be variances. That's part of their charm. But if you prefer precision to a more free form style, these probably aren't for you. They range in size, but the average dimensions are 3.5" tall and 2.2" in diameter.

Rancho Gordo-Xoxoc Project
These items are the results of our two companies working together since 2008 to help small farmers and producers continue to grow their indigenous products in Mexico, despite international trade policies that seem to discourage genetic diversity and local food traditions.
